YOGYAKARTA Digital wallet or e-wallet (ewallet) is currently widely used by the public. One of the reasons why ewallet is liked is its practicality. If you are one of the users, the use of ewallet must still be accompanied by caution. It is not recommended to place all your funds on the ewallet. Then what is the nominal that is safe to store on the ewallet?

To answer this question, many things need to be considered, especially how often you use the digital wallet.

It should be noted that ewallet still has a vulnerability to hacking. This means that fund owners have the potential to lose their money when stored in the electric wallet. Especially if you choose an ewallet developer that is not managed properly. Because of this condition, it is also not recommended to store hundreds of millions of funds in a digital wallet. However, you can save money according to your daily needs.

For example, you are a public transportation user whose payments can be made via ewallet. Try to calculate in one period (can be weekly or monthly), how much it costs to pay for the transportation you use. So the amount of funds that can be stored on the ewallet is only that limited. This means that the storage of funds on the ewallet should not be more than the amount of your needs.

The shortage of ewallet is the reason why you are not advised to save too much money on the platform. Some of these deficiencies are as follows.

Some ewallet developers really prioritize cybersecurity towards their services. However, the risk of hacking persists. In fact, the fraud from the developer is quite large.

It doesn't stop there, the potential for leakage of personal information is also a very big consideration. Users of digital wallets can become victims of fraudulent or harmful scams.

As is known, ewallet relies heavily on smartphones as its device. On the other hand, users can lose access to these phones because they are damaged, criminal victims, and so on. This reason is also the basis why large fund storage on ewallet is not recommended.
